Ethics in Weatherization

Most of us are regularly faced with ethical questions in our work. Should we accept gifts from clients? Is it proper to purchase valuable antiques from clients? What is the best action if we notice domestic violence? Is it ethical to have a sexual relationship with a client? Some ethical questions are easily answered with a simple “yes” or “no”, but others need further thought or discussion. This session will help weatherization crews, auditors, inspectors, and managers define what is ethical and what is not. Your participation and stories about your experiences are welcome and encouraged.

By attending this session, participants will

1. Learn about the ways ethics affect your daily actions on the job

2. Recognize the importance of establishing a code of ethics or a code of conduct for your organization

3. Have a better understanding of simple methods for making ethical decisions in your work life and in your interactions with clients, suppliers, and fellow workers
